Description:
This is the leftmost layback crack on the Phantasia wall. 25 ft up you'll see a Rhododendron tree with an old piece of webbing on it. From here, the climbing is REALLY easy, minus loads of dirt to scramble and slip on as you find some roundabout way to the anchors - which consist of a bunch of old webbings wrapped around a bigger Rhododendron.
